Image for Event-B

Event-B

Event-B is a formal method used in computer science and engineering for modeling and designing complex systems. It focuses on the development of software and hardware by creating mathematical models that define system behaviors and properties. By specifying systems in terms of "events" that cause changes, Event-B helps identify potential errors early in the design process, ensuring reliability and correctness. It is particularly useful in critical applications, such as aerospace and automotive systems, where failures can have serious consequences. This method enables systematic reasoning and verification of the system's requirements and behaviors before implementation.